Original Article:
Investigation of Frequency Distribution of Breast Imaging Reporting and Data System (BIRADS) Classification and Epidemiological Factors Related to Breast Cancer in Iran: A 7-year Study (2010–2016)
Mehri Sirous, Parisa Sotoodeh Shahnani, Amirmasoud Sirous
Adv Biomed Res
2018, 7:56 (27 March 2018)
DOI
:10.4103/abr.abr_161_17
PMID
:29657941
Background:
The first cause of women mortality due to cancer is breast cancer. Mammography plays a central part in early detection of breast cancers. The screening methods can play a major role to reduce the morbidity and mortality rate due to this malignancy. We sought the basic data in this study on our population because knowing about the baseline data is apt and vital.
Materials and Methods:
In this study, data were collected from a questionnaire, contained baseline bio data information, and mammographic imaging of the patients came during 7 years. Breast imaging reporting and data system (BIRADS) score, breast composition, presence of axillary lymph nodes, microcalcifications, and other incidental positive findings were determined by a radiologist and analysis was performed by SPSS package.
Results:
The most common indication for mammography was annual screening. The mean age of participants to the study was 55 ± 7.9 years. The majority (80%) of the patients with known breast cancer (BIRADS 6) had the extremely dense breast. The most common incidental findings in mammogram studies were focal asymmetry, architectural distortion, intramammary lymph node and accessory breasts, respectively.
Conclusion:
The frequency distribution of BIRADS classification in our society was clarified. It seems that the breast cancer risk is higher in women with dense breasts. Architectural distortion was also correlated to BIRADS score.

Original Article:
Levofloxacin-containing versus Clarithromycin-containing Therapy for
Helicobacter pylori
Eradication: A Prospective Randomized Controlled Clinical Trial
Vahid Sebghatollahi, Maryam Soheilipour, Mahsa Khodadoostan, Alireza Shavakhi, Ahmad Shavakhi
Adv Biomed Res
2018, 7:55 (27 March 2018)
DOI
:10.4103/abr.abr_133_17
PMID
:29657940
Background:
This study evaluated the clinical efficacy and tolerability of a 14-day course of bismuth-based quadruple therapy including tinidazole and levofloxacin in compare to a 14-day bismuth-based quadruple therapy including clarithromycin as first-line treatment for
Helicobacter pylori
infection in Iranian adults.
Materials and Methods:
The study was a prospective, parallel group, randomized controlled, clinical trial that conducted on 150 patients with
H. pylori
infection. Patients were randomly assigned to the two groups as follows: first group received pantoprazole 40 mg, bismuth subcitrate 240 mg, amoxicillin 1 g, and clarithromycin 500 mg (PBAC group), and other group received pantoprazole 40 mg, bismuth subcitrate 240 mg, amoxicillin 1 g, tinidazole 500 mg for 7 days, followed by levofloxacin 500 mg for the second 7 days (PBATL group). Main outcomes were eradication rate, tolerance of treatment, and dyspepsia severity.
Results:
The eradication rates for PBAC regimen was 81.1% (95% confidence interval [CI]: 71.9–90.2) and for PBATL regimen was 70.8% (95% CI: 60.1–81.6), which was not significantly different (
P
= 0.147). Tolerance of treatment was similar between groups. The median of severity of dyspeptic after treatment in PBAC group was 10 [9–14.75], which was similar to PBATL group 10 [9–13.5] (
P
= 0.690).
Conclusion:
There is no significant difference between PBAC and PBATL regimen, and efficacy was similar in both groups. The overall rate of treatment failure suggests that up to 18%–30% of patients will fail bismuth-based quadruple therapy and require retreatment for the infection.

Brief Communication:
Cisplatin Alters Sodium Excretion and Renal Clearance in Rats: Gender and Drug Dose Related
Sima Jilanchi, Ardeshir Talebi, Mehdi Nematbakhsh
Adv Biomed Res
2018, 7:54 (27 March 2018)
DOI
:10.4103/abr.abr_124_17
PMID
:29657939
Background:
Nephrotoxicity is one of the side effects of cisplatin (CP) therapy which is gender related. CP disturbs renal function through glomerular filtration rate and electrolytes transport disturbances. This study was designed to compare some markers related to renal function in two protocols of CP treatment in rats.
Materials and Methods:
Male and female rats were subjected to receive single (treat 1; 7.5 mg/kg) and continues doses (treat 2; 3 mg/kg/day for 5 days) of CP, and the measurements were compared with control animals.
Results:
The serum level of blood urea nitrogen (BUN) and creatinine (Cr), and Cr-clearance, kidney tissue damage score, kidney weight, body weight change, and Na excretion was altered significantly (
P
< 0.05) in animals treated with continuous dose of CP (treat 2), while alteration of BUN and Cr was gender related. The kidney levels of malondialdehyde and nitrite were significantly different between male and female in two protocols of treatments.
Conclusion:
Renal function after CP therapy alters in rats' gender dependently, and it is related to protocol of treatment.

Original Article:
Formulation of Herbal Gel of
Antirrhinum majus
Extract and Evaluation of its Anti-
Propionibacterium acne
Effects
Mohammad Ali Shahtalebi, Gholam Reza Asghari, Farideh Rahmani, Fatemeh Shafiee, Ali Jahanian-Najafabadi
Adv Biomed Res
2018, 7:53 (27 March 2018)
DOI
:10.4103/abr.abr_99_17
PMID
:29657938
Background:
Antirrhinum majus
contains aurone with excellent antibacterial and antifungal activities. In addition, visible light activates the endogenous porphyrins of
Propionibacterium acne
, which results in bacterial death. Therefore, considering the above-mentioned facts, the aim of the present study was to prepare a topical herbal gel of
A. majus
hydroalcoholic extract and to evaluate its antiacne effects with or without blue light combination as an activator of the porphyrins.
Materials and Methods:
Antibacterial activity of the shoot or petal extracts was evaluated by disc diffusion method and the minimum inhibitory concentration (MIC) was calculated. Various gel formulations were developed by the Experimental Design software. The obtained gel formulations were prepared and tested for pharmaceutical parameters including organoleptic features, pH, viscosity, drug content, and release studies. Finally, the antibacterial activity was evaluated against (
P. acnes
) with or without blue light.
Results:
The MIC of the extracts showed to be 0.25 μg/ml. Evaluation of the gel formulation showed acceptable properties of the best formulation in comparison to a gel in the market. Pharmaceutical parameters were also in accordance with the standard parameters of the marketed gel. Furthermore, statistical analyses showed significant antibacterial effect for gel when compared to negative control. However, combination of blue light with gel did not show any significant difference on the observed antibacterial effect.
Conclusion:
Because of the statistically significant
in vitro
antiacne effects of the formulated gel, further clinical studies for evaluation of the healing effects of the prepared gel formulation on acne lesions must be performed.

Original Article:
The Role of Angiotensin II Infusion on the Baroreflex Sensitivity and Renal Function in Intact and Bilateral Renal Denervation Rats
Mohammad Karim Azadbakht, Jalal Hassanshahi, Mehdi Nematbakhsh
Adv Biomed Res
2018, 7:52 (27 March 2018)
DOI
:10.4103/abr.abr_192_17
PMID
:29657937
Background:
The role of renin-angiotensin system (RAS) in communication between renal system and cardiovascular system is extremely important. Baroreflex sensitivity (BRS) index defines as heart rate (HR) alteration versus mean arterial pressure (MAP) change ratio (ΔHR/ΔMAP) . Sympathetic nerve is arm of the baroreflexes and any change in its activity will lead to change in the BRS. The role of angiotensin II (Ang II) infusion in systemic circulation accompanied with bilateral renal denervation (RDN) on BRS index and renal function was studied.
Materials and Methods:
Seventy-two male and female Wistar rats in 12 groups were anesthetized and catheterized. The alteration of MAP and HR responses to phenylephrine infusion compared to control groups was determined in bilateral RDN rats subjected to treat with Ang II (300 or 1000 ng/kg/min) administration.
Results:
The BRS index was elevated in Ang II-treated non-RDN (normal) male rats gradually and dose dependently (
P
< 0.05), while this index was significantly different when compared with RDN male rats (
P
< 0.05). Accordingly, the BRS index was significantly lower in RDN than non-RDN male rats, and such observation was not observed in female rats. The creatinine clearance (insignificantly) and urine flow (significantly;
P
< 0.05) were decreased in both non-RDN and RDN male and female rats treated with Ang II. In RDN model, the serum nitrite levels were decreased in male and increased in female by Ang II infusion when compared with vehicle infusion.
Conclusion:
The Ang II infusion could increase the BRS index in non-RDN (normal) male rats which is significantly greater than BRS index in RDN rats.

Case Report:
Cellular Therapy for Chronic Traumatic Brachial Plexus Injury
Alok Sharma, Hemangi Sane, Nandini Gokulchandran, Prerna Badhe, Suhasini Pai, Pooja Kulkarni, Jayanti Yadav, Sanket Inamdar
Adv Biomed Res
2018, 7:51 (27 March 2018)
DOI
:10.4103/2277-9175.228631
PMID
:29657936
Cellular therapy is being actively pursued as a therapeutic modality in many of the neurological diseases. A variety of stem cells from diverse sources have been studied in detail and have been shown to exhibit angiogenetic and immunomodulatory properties in addition to other neuroprotective effects. Published clinical data have shown bone marrow mononuclear cell (BMMNC) injection in neurological disorders is safe and possesses regenerative potential. We illustrate a case of 27-year-old male with traumatic brachial plexus injury, administered with autologous BMMNCs intrathecally and intramuscularly, followed by multidisciplinary rehabilitation. At the follow-up assessment of 3 and 7 months after first cell transplantation, improvements were recorded in muscle strength and movements. Electromyography (EMG) performed after the intervention showed a response in biceps and deltoid muscles suggesting the process of reinnervation at the site of injury. In view of the improvements observed after the treatment, the patient underwent second cell transplantation 8 months after the first transplantation. Muscle wasting had completely stopped with an increase in the muscle girth. No adverse effects were noted. Improvements were maintained for 4 years. A comprehensive randomized study for this type of injury is needed to establish the therapeutic benefits of cellular therapy.

Original Article:
Comparison of Wound Tape and Suture Wounds on Traumatic Wounds' Scar
Mehrdad Esmailian, Reza Azizkhani, Aliakbar Jangjoo, Mehdi Nasr, Sirous Nemati
Adv Biomed Res
2018, 7:49 (27 March 2018)
DOI
:10.4103/abr.abr_148_16
PMID
:29657934
Background:
Several methods have been used in wound closure for traumatic wounds, but it is not clear that which of these methods has more safety and efficacy. This study aimed to compare scar width due to standard and current treatments in wound repair by suturing and method of wound restoration using wound tape in patients with traumatic ulcers.
Materials and Methods:
This randomized clinical trial was done in ninety patients with wounds in the facial area. They were divided randomly into two groups of 45. The wounds in the first group were sutured, and wound tapes were used to wound closure in the second group. After 2 months, length and width of scar and results of life-size photography were recorded in a list, especially prepared for this purpose.
Results:
The mean age of the patients was 22.7 ± 12.9 years with 46 males (56.1%) and 36 females (43.9%). After 2 months, scars width in suture wound group was 2.9 mm and in wound tape group was 2.5 mm, with no statistically significant difference (
P
= 0.07). In patients with wound length of >20 mm, scars width was similar between groups and no significant differences was noted (
P
= 0.27), but in patients with wound length of <20 mm, scars width in wound tape group was significantly less than suture wound group (1.7 vs. 2.5 mm, respectively,
P
= 0.01). Wound complications were not significantly different between the two groups.
Conclusion:
Findings revealed that scar formation in wounds lower than 20 mm treated using wound tape was lower than suture, but for wounds between 20 and 50 mm were similar between wound tape and suture.

Original Article:
Relationship between Height of Ethmoid Skull Base and Length of Lateral Lamella by Sectional Coronal Computed Tomography Scan before Endoscopic Sinus Surgery
Seyyed Mustafa Hashemi, Nezamoddin Berjis, Hamidreza Ebrahimi
Adv Biomed Res
2018, 7:48 (27 March 2018)
DOI
:10.4103/abr.abr_109_15
PMID
:29657933
Background:
Damage to ethmoid skull base (ESB) and lateral lamella (LL) during endoscopic sinus surgery (ESS) causes penetration into the brain. This study is aimed to determine the relationship between the height of ESB and length of LL by sectional coronal computed tomography (CT) scans before ESS.
Materials and Methods:
In a cross-sectional study, 100 patients admitted to ENT clinic of Al-Zahra Hospital, filled the consents regarding the use of CT scan stereotype. Each stereotype was evaluated and using the software on two sides the height of ESB and the length of LL were measured, investigated and recorded. Next, the maximum and minimum height and length in the two sides was measured, and its mean calculated. Then, the relationship between the length of LL and the height of ESB was investigated.
Results:
There was a direct correlation, with the rate of 0.25 between the length of right LL and height of right ESB that was significant according to Pearson test (
P
= 0.013). Also, the rate of correlation between the left LL and height of left ESB was 0.15 that was not significant according to Pearson test (
P
= 0.15).
Conclusion:
Based on this study there was a direct correlation between height of the right ESB and the length of LL, but this correlation is very low, about 0.25 and even this correlation was lower in the case of left, about 0.15, which both of them are not significant. This may be due to other affecting factors, such as length, slope and angle of fovea ethmoidallis from the horizontal line.

Original Article:
Normative Ulnar Nerve Conduction Study: Comparison of Two Measurement Methods
Shila Haghighat, Amir Ebrahim Mahmoodian, Lida Kianimehr
Adv Biomed Res
2018, 7:47 (27 March 2018)
DOI
:10.4103/abr.abr_91_16
PMID
:29657932
Background:
Given the high prevalence rate of ulnar neuropathy and importance of its proper management, to have a baseline information about the normative value of motor nerve conduction of first dorsal interosseous (FDI) muscle and abductor digiti minimi muscle (ADM) and their differences as well as their relation with different demographic characteristics of our population, we aimed to determine and compare the mean value of motor conduction velocity of FDI and ADM at forearm and across the elbow among the normal population.
Materials and Methods:
In this cross-sectional study, healthy participants were enrolled in the study. Ulnar nerve motor nerve conduction velocity (MNCV) was recorded from the ADM and the FDI at forearm and across the elbow. Mean MNCV of the ulnar nerve recorded from ADM and FDI was compared. In addition, MNCV of the ulnar nerve measured at the forearm and across the elbow was compared also.
Results:
During this study, 165 healthy volunteers selected and participated in the study. Mean of ulnar nerve MNCV for ADM was significantly lower than FDI, both at forearm and across the elbow (
P
< 0.001). Mean of ulnar nerve MNCV was significantly lower at forearm comparing than elbow level for both ADM and FDI (
P
< 0.001).
Conclusion:
The findings of the current study provide us a baseline data regarding the normative mean value of ulnar nerve MNCV in different locations, which could be used for providing an appropriate diagnostic protocol for ulnar nerve neuropathy. However, further studies among patients suspected with ulnar nerve neuropathy are needed.

Original Article:
Evaluation of Seizure Frequency Distribution in Epileptic Patients with Normal and Abnormal Electroencephalogram in Al-Zahra Hospital of Isfahan
Mohmmad Reza Najafi, Rokhsareh Meamar, Nafiseh Karimi
Adv Biomed Res
2018, 7:46 (27 March 2018)
DOI
:10.4103/abr.abr_279_16
PMID
:29657931
Background:
Epilepsy is a chronic neurological disorder characterized by seizure recurrence in patients. Electroencephalogram (EEG) has a diagnostic and prognostic role in the management of patients. Studies have shown a significant relation between seizure recurrence and abnormal EEG in newly diagnosed epileptic patients, and people with first episode of unprovoked seizure. The aim of this study is to evaluate seizure frequency in chronic epileptic patients on drug therapy based on normal or abnormal EEG.
Materials and Methods:
This prospective cohort study examined seizure recurrence in 59 epileptic patients (50.8% generalized, 49.2% focal) with normal and abnormal EEG. Data were recorded in patient medical file, and patients were followed by telephone call or visiting by neurologist.
Results:
In this study, 59 patients with a mean age of 29.58 ± 10.37 years were assessed that 42.4% of them were males and 57.6% were females. Seizure frequency in patient with specific abnormal EEG was significantly more than other patients (specific abnormal: 78.9%, nonspecific abnormal: 45.5%, and normal: 31%,
P
= 0.005). Seizure recurrence in patients on polytherapy was significantly higher than others (polytherapy: 76.9% and monotherapy: 27.3%,
P
< 0.001). In patient with abnormal imaging seizure, frequency was more than other patients which was nearly significant (
P
= 0.054).
Conclusion:
Abnormal EEG and number of anticonvulsant drugs have a role in seizure recurrence in epileptic patients.

Original Article:
Establishment and Development of the First Biobank of Inflammatory Bowel Disease, Suspected to Primary Immunodeficiency Diseases in Iran
Roya Sherkat, Soodabeh Rostami, Majid Yaran, Mohammad Hassan Emami, Hosein Saneian, Hamid Tavakoli, Peyman Adibi, Mahdieh Behnam, Saba Sheykhbahaei, Bahram Bagherpour, Razieh Khoshnevisan, Somayeh Najafi
Adv Biomed Res
2018, 7:45 (27 March 2018)
DOI
:10.4103/abr.abr_278_16
PMID
:29657930
Background:
Inflammatory bowel disease (IBD) might be an immunodeficiency rather than an excessive inflammatory reaction. IBD, suspected to primary immunodeficiency diseases biobank (IBDSPIDB) as a resource for researches can help improve the prevention, diagnosis, and illness treatment and the health promotion throughout the society. Therefore, we launched the biobank of IBDSPID for the first time in Iran.
Materials and Methods:
This study was designed to provide the IBDSPIDB to have a high-quality DNA, RNA, and cDNA. Among of 365 patients, 39 have inclusion criteria that were as below: (1) IBD diagnosis before 5 years of age. (2) Resistance to conventional therapy of IBD. (3) Severe IBD. (4) Signs of SPID (including ear infections or pneumonia or recurrent sinus within the 1-year period; failure to thrive; poor response to the prolonged use of antibiotics; persistent thrush or skin abscesses; or a family history of PID).
Results:
Out of 39 patients, 51.3% were males. The mean age was 32.92 ± 15.90 years old. Ulcerative colitis (79.5%) was more than Crohn's disease. The majority of patients (50.0%) had severe IBDSPID. Resistance to drugs and consanguinity was 12.9% and 47.4%, respectively. Age at onset in 65.8% of patients was after 17 years old. Patients with autoimmune, allergy, and immunodeficiency disease history were 33.3%, 33.3%, and 10.36%, respectively. RNA and cDNA yields large quantities of high-quality DNA obtained and stored.
Conclusion:
Our biobank would be valuable for future genetic and molecular study to be more about the relation between IBD and PID.

Original Article:
Poly(hydroxybutyrate)/chitosan Aligned Electrospun Scaffold as a Novel Substrate for Nerve Tissue Engineering
Afarin Karimi, Saeed Karbasi, Shahnaz Razavi, Elham Naghash Zargar
Adv Biomed Res
2018, 7:44 (27 March 2018)
DOI
:10.4103/abr.abr_277_16
PMID
:29657929
Background:
Reconstruction of nervous system is a great challenge in the therapeutic medical field. Nerve tissue engineering is a novel method to regenerate nervous system in human health care. Tissue engineering has introduced novel approaches to promote and guide peripheral nerve regeneration using submicron and nanoscale fibrous scaffolds.
Materials and Methods:
In this study, 9 wt% poly(3-hydroxybutyrate) (PHB) solutions with two different ratios of chitosan (CTS) (15%, and 20%) were mixed in trifluoroacetic acid as a cosolvent. Thereafter, random and aligned PHB/CTS scaffolds were fabricated by electrospinning method in an appropriate condition.
Results:
Average diameters for aligned PHB, PHB/CTS 85:15 and PHB/CTS 80:20 were obtained as 675 nm, 740.3 nm, and 870.74 nm, which was lesser than random fibers. The solution components entity authenticity was approved by Fourier transform infrared. The addition of CTS decreased both water droplet contact angle from 124.79° to 43.14° in random and 110.87° to 33.49° in aligned PHB/CTS fibrous scaffold. Moreover, alignment of fibers causes tremendous increase in hydrophilicity of fibrous PHB/CTS substrate. Tensile strength increased from 6.41 MPa for random to 8.73 MPa for aligned PHB/CTS 85:15.
Conclusions:
Our results indicated that aligned PHB/CTS 85:15 nanofibers are the desired scaffold than the random PHB/CTS nanofibers for application in nerve tissue regeneration.

Original Article:
Cytotoxicity of
Sargassum angustifolium
Partitions against Breast and Cervical Cancer Cell Lines
Golnaz Vaseghi, Mohsen Sharifi, Nasim Dana, Ahmad Ghasemi, Afsaneh Yegdaneh
Adv Biomed Res
2018, 7:43 (27 March 2018)
DOI
:10.4103/abr.abr_259_16
PMID
:29657928
Background:
Marine organisms produce a variety of compounds with pharmacological activities including anticancer effects. This study attempt to find cytotoxicity of hexane (HEX), dichloromethane (DCM), and butanol (BUTOH) partitions of
Sargassum angustifolium
.
Materials and Methods:
S. angustifolium
was collected from Bushehr, a Southwest coastline of Persian Gulf. The plant was extracted by maceration with methanol-ethyl acetate. The extract was evaporated under vacuum and partitioned by Kupchan method to yield HEX, DCM, and BUTOH partitions. The cytotoxic activity of the extract (150, 450, and 900 μg/ml) was investigated against MCF-7 (breast cancer), HeLa (cervical cancer), and human umbilical vein endothelial cells cell lines by mitochondrial tetrazolium test assay after 72 h.
Results:
The cell survivals of HeLa and MCF-7 cell were decreased by increasing the concentration of extracts from 150 μg/ml to 900 μg/ml. The median growth inhibitory concentration value of HEX partition was 71 and 77 μg/ml against HeLa and MCF-7, dichloromethane partition was 36 and 88 μg/ml against HeLa and MCF-7, respectively. BUTOH partition was 25 μg/ml against MCF-7.
Conclusion:
This study reveals that different partitions of
S. angustifolium
have cytotoxic activity against cancer cell lines.

Original Article:
Gene Expression Analysis of Two Epithelial-mesenchymal Transition-related Genes: Long Noncoding
RNA-ATB
and
SETD8
in Gastric Cancer Tissues
Nooshin Nourbakhsh, Modjtaba Emadi-Baygi, Rasoul Salehi, Parvaneh Nikpour
Adv Biomed Res
2018, 7:42 (27 March 2018)
DOI
:10.4103/abr.abr_252_16
PMID
:29657927
Background:
Cancer is the second cause of death after cardiovascular diseases worldwide. Tumor metastasis is the main cause of death in patients with cancer; therefore, unraveling the molecular mechanisms involved in metastasis is critical. Epithelial-mesenchymal transition (EMT) is believed to promote tumor metastasis. Based on the critical roles of long noncoding
RNA-ATB
(
lncRNA-ATB
) and
SETD8
genes in cancer pathogenesis and EMT, in this study, we aimed to assess expression profile and clinicopathological relevance of these two genes in human gastric cancer.
Materials and Methods:
Quantitative real-time polymerase chain reaction was performed to assess these gene expressions in gastric cancer tissues and various cell lines. The associations between these gene expressions and clinicopathological characteristics were also analyzed.
Results:
Insignificant downregulation of
lncRNA-ATB
and significant upregulation of
SETD8
in cancerous versus noncancerous gastric tissues were observed. Among different examined cell lines, all displayed both genes expression. Except for a significant inverse correlation between the expression levels of
lncRNA-ATB
and depth of invasion (T) and a direct association between
SETD8
levels and advanced tumor grades, no significant association was found with other clinicopathological characteristics.
Conclusion:
lncRNA-ATB
and
SETD8
genes may play a critical role in gastric cancer progression and may serve as potential diagnostic/prognostic biomarkers in cancer patients.

Original Article:
Efficacy of Group Cognitive–behavioral Therapy in Maintenance Treatment and Relapse Prevention for Bipolar Adolescents
Soroor Arman, Farnaz Golmohammadi, Mohammad Reza Maracy, Mitra Molaeinezhad
Adv Biomed Res
2018, 7:41 (27 March 2018)
DOI
:10.4103/abr.abr_168_16
PMID
:29657926
Background:
Despite conducting wide-ranging of pharmacotherapy for bipolar adolescents, many of them are showing a deficit in functioning with high relapse rate. The aim of the current study was to develop a manual and investigate the efficacy of group cognitive–behavioral therapy (G-CBT) for female bipolar adolescents.
Materials and Methods:
During the first qualitative phase of a mixed-methods study, a manual of G-CBT was developed. Then, 32 female bipolar adolescents aged 12–19 years old, receiving usual maintenance medications (UMM), were selected. Participants were randomized to the control (UMM) and intervention group (5, 2 h weekly sessions based on G-CBT manual with UMM). The parents in intervention group participated in three parallel sessions. All participants filled the following questionnaires before 1, 3, and 6 months after the initiation of the study: Young Mania Rating Scale, Children Depression Inventory and Global Assessment of Functioning. The results were analyzed using SPSS 21 software. The concurrent qualitative phase was analyzed through thematic analysis.
Results:
The results showed no significant differences in all questionnaires' scores through intervention and follow-up sessions (
P
> 0.05). However, using cutoff point of CDI, G-CBT was effective for intervention group (relapse rate: 25% vs. 44.4%). Two themes were extracted from the second qualitative phase: emotion recognition and emotion regulation, especially in anger control.
Conclusions:
The results showed that the addition of G-CBT to UMM leads to decrease in the depressive scores but has no effect on manic symptoms and relapse rate.

Research Article:
Biofilm Formation in Nonmultidrug-resistant
Escherichia coli
Isolated from Patients with Urinary Tract Infection in Isfahan, Iran
Farkhondeh Poursina, Shima Sepehrpour, Sina Mobasherizadeh
Adv Biomed Res
2018, 7:40 (27 March 2018)
DOI
:10.4103/abr.abr_116_17
PMID
:29657925
Background:
Escherichia coli
is a Gram-negative, opportunistic human pathogen in which increasing antibiotic resistance is a great concern for continued human survival. Although biofilm formation is a mechanism that helps
E. coli
to survive in unfavorable conditions, according to the importance of biofilm formation in developing the antibiotic resistance here, we studied the relation between antibiotic resistance and
in vitro
qualitative rating method biofilm formation in
E. coli
isolated from patients with urinary tract infection (UTI).
Materials and Methods:
The clinical isolates of
E. coli
(
n
= 100) were collected from urine of patients with UTI attending Isfahan Alzahra hospital. The strains were confirmed as
E. coli
using biochemical tests and molecular method. The Kirby-Bauer disk diffusion tests were done according to the Clinical and Laboratory Standards Institute protocol, and the biofilm synthesis was performed by microplate method. The binary logistic test was applied and
P
< 0.05 was considered statistically significant.
Results:
Our results showed a high outbreak of multidrug-resistant (MDR)
E. coli
strains (73%) and the highest resistance was observed toward ampicillin. The prevalence of biofilm producer isolates was 80% that 29% produced strong biofilm. The distribution of non-MDR isolates was high among strong biofilm producers, which shows a significant negative correlation between biofilm production and MDR pattern (
P
< 0.001).
Conclusions:
We found a negative correlation between MDR phenotype and biofilm formation capacity. This transmits the concept that more antibiotic susceptibility of strong biofilm producers may be due to the reduced exposure to multiple antibiotics.
